John Jones Schrack (age 5) was in Norristown in 1850, having been born in OK territory. He was living with his father's sister.
His father, Lewis May Schrack , had just remarried in Paris Texas.

now let's look at John Jones Schrack's older cousin: Judge Lewis Schrack Wells who seems to have married Virginia Throop in the same paklce at roughtly the same time:

Question: Did Lewis Schracl Wells and Virginia marry in Lamar Texas? If so, it would be a coincidence that Lewis May Schrack (her husband's close relative) also married there. see familysearch =

This would tie the fortunes of the Lewis May Schrack, who married his second wife in Lamar TX.
"He (Lewis May Schrack {1818-1883}) was married (a second time) in Paris, Texas, on the 6th of May, 1849, to Susan Bartlette Holman, and six weeks later crossed the plains to California.
